Output e89e288df1ad26d2fccba9cc7c256e23f78af8589dcbffc5f6cfda8f322eec40:1

value
535885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7600ac2d31d02846040e284c4b58c26bdc4d3cd7 OP_EQUAL
address
3CSxTukgFmGCmhK1VasEZBN2xjrFwpaAkN
transaction
e89e288df1ad26d2fccba9cc7c256e23f78af8589dcbffc5f6cfda8f322eec40
spent
true